About Gordon Stewart Anderson

  • Gordon Stewart Anderson (1958 – July 8, 1991) was a Canadian writer, whose novel The Toronto You Are Leaving was published by his mother 15 years after his death.Anderson was born in Hamilton, Ontario, raised in Sault Ste.
  • Marie and lived for many years in Toronto.
  • He graduated from the University of Waterloo and the University of Western Ontario.
  • A gay man, Anderson died of AIDS-related causes.
  • He is remembered on the Canadian AIDS Memorial Quilt. [Three] years after his death, his mother Marlene Lloyd discovered that a small publishing house had an unpublished manuscript for The Toronto You Are Leaving, a novel Anderson had written about life in Toronto's gay community in the late 1970s.
  • She submitted the manuscript to several other publishers without success, and eventually edited and self-published the novel herself in 2006.
  • The novel garnered a strong review in The Globe and Mail, as well as significant attention in Canada's gay press. Marlene Lloyd had also previously published a book of her own, Not a Total Waste: The True Story of a Mother, Her Son and AIDS, about Anderson's death.
